Recently booked in Delhi
Skeet Ball Game
Skeet Ball Game
Drop a Dope Game
Drop a Dope Game
Live Food Counter Catering
Live Food Counter Catering
Tic Tac Toe Game Inflatable
Tic Tac Toe Game Inflatable